WebFor some people, hearing aids do not help and instead they need to have a special device fitted inside or to their skull during an operation. These are known as hearing implants. Common types of implant include bone anchored hearing aids, cochlear implants, auditory brainstem implants and middle ear implants. Bone anchored hearing aids. Web21 feb. 2024 · I would say a typical lifespan of hearing aid would be around 5 years. However, the hearing aid will have to go in for repair before it hits that 5-year mark. I have seen people wear hearing aids for longer than 5 years, sometimes up to 8 or 9 years however here are some factors to consider.
